Perfect for river tubing
I bought these for a summer of tubing on the Guadeloupe River in central Texas. They worked wonderfully. They fit as expected, did not feel heavy at all, drained really quickly, and were actually comfortable enough for walking between the 2nd and 3rd crossings. Also, these shoes were very stable and "grippy" when I had to walk across slippery rocks in various parts of the river. To clean them, I removed the removable inner sole, and threw the shoes and inner soles into the washing machine along with towels. Then let them air dry. After five separate days of river tubing over the course of the summer, they honestly look as good as new.

Provide good grip, rock protection, and shed water quite well.
PSP - price, shipping, packaging were great.DESIGN - the fit is a bit big. I wear 8.5 or 9, and these (8.5) are a little too big, which leaves more space for water and reduces grip. The laces do not offer much tightening as the side fabric stretches. The insole has no holes, and the sole is slightly cupped so they do hold a little water. Otherwise comfortable and appear strong enough for moderate use.FUNCTION - Grips boat deck and paddle board surfaces well, while protecting foot from sharp rocky surfaces. Dry well, although the insole dries faster if removed. Easy to slide on, easy to swim with.I could recommend these easily. Excellent price for a good design that functions quite well. But if you want a snug fit for grip in active sports, consider ordering the correct size.(For me down one size of my normal USA shoe size.)
